Earl Clark continued to struggle with his shot in Friday's preseason win, hitting just 1-of-7 shots for four points, three rebounds and one steal in 22 minutes. Luckily for Clark his competition in C.J. Miles (nine points, 3-of-8 FGs) and Alonzo Gee (DNP) are both known quantities and it's doubtful the Cavs are pushing for either of them to beat out their free agent acquisition. That said, Clark is a bit out of position at SF and he's not going to be given run of the yard -- he needs to start hitting shots or lose his shot at starter's minutes -- and he likely will.
